How Bamboo Traps Heat Without Bulk

Unlike traditional insulating materials, bamboo doesn’t rely on thickness for warmth. Instead, its unique fiber structure contains microscopic air channels that act as natural insulators. These tiny pockets retain body heat while allowing excess moisture to escape—keeping you warm, dry, and comfortable. This makes bamboo clothing warm in winter even when layered under outerwear.

  • High thermal efficiency per gram of material
  • Regulates body temperature better than cotton or synthetics
  • Excellent for active lifestyles in cold climates

Maximizing Warmth: Tips for Winter Bamboo Wear

To get the most out of your bamboo garments in winter:

  • Use bamboo as a base layer beneath insulated jackets or sweaters
  • Choose thicker bamboo blends (e.g., bamboo-cotton or bamboo-merino) for extreme cold
  • Wear multiple thin layers instead of one bulky one for better temperature control
  • Pair with thermal accessories like bamboo socks and scarves

With proper layering, bamboo clothing is warm in winter and far more versatile than many realize.
